Charitable objects
THE MAIN PURPOSES OF THE WOMEN'S INSTITUTE ORGANISATION ARE TO ENABLE WOMEN WHO ARE INTERESTED IN ISSUES ASSOCIATED WITH RURAL LIFE, INCLUDING ARTS, CRAFTS AND SCIENCES, TO IMPROVE AND DEVELOP CONDITIONS OF RURAL LIFE, TO ADVANCE THEIR EDUCATION IN CITIZENSHIP, IN PUBLIC QUESTIONS BOTH NATIONAL AND INTERNATIONAL, IN MUSIC, DRAMA AND OTHER CULTURAL SUBJECTS AND IN ALL BRANCHES OF AGRICULTURE, HANDICRAFTS, HOME ECONOMICS, HEALTH AND SOCIAL WELFARE. IT SEEKS TO GIVE WOMEN THE OPPORTUNITY OF WORKING TOGETHER THROUGH THE WOMEN'S INSTITUTE ORGANISATION AND OF PUTTING INTO PRACTICE THOSE IDEALS FOR WHICH IT STANDS.
